Answer / c.saranya
When we are installing the Veritas Volume Manager by
default rootdg will be created.While installing we must add
the root file system under this veritas control.Then only
after rebooting root will boot from this veritas.

How to mirror a rootdg
Initialize a new disk
#devfsadm
#format ( to label the disk)
#vxdctl –enable
#vxdisksetup –I diskname (c0t1d0s2)
#vxdg –g rootdg adddisk rootnew=c0t1d0s2
#vxprint list
#vxrootmir rootnew
